Dr John E Sarno is a medical pioneer whose programme has helped thousands of patients overcome their back conditions - without drugs, without surgery, and even without exercise. He demonstrates how, after identifying stress and other psychological factors underlying back pain, many of his patients have then gone on to heal themselves without physical therapy. He explains how anxiety and repressed anger can often be the real triggers of back pain - even when physical conditions such as herniated discs have been diagnosed - and why self-motivated and successful people are particularly prone to this kind of problem, which he calls TMS (Tension Myositis Syndrome). With case histories and the results of in-depth mind-body research, Dr Sarno describes how patients recognize the emotional roots of their TMS and sever the connections between mental and physical pain... and how, just by reading this book, you may start recovering from back pain today.
